Automotive parts often require intricate designs and precise tolerances. Flat CNC lathes offer a solution by enabling manufacturers to create complex geometries with ease. Unlike traditional lathes, the flat CNC lathe allows for multi-axis machining, which is essential for crafting parts that must fit together seamlessly.
One of the standout features of flat CNC lathes is their multi-axis capabilities. This allows manufacturers to work on multiple facets of a part simultaneously, dramatically reducing machining time. With the ability to pivot and rotate, operators can create detailed shapes that were previously labor-intensive or impossible to achieve with conventional lathes.
The efficiency of automotive part production is largely enhanced by advanced CNC controller technology. A CNC controller is the heart of any CNC lathe, providing the calculations and commands necessary for machine operation. With superior software integration, operators can program intricate specifications that ensure high precision in machining processes.
CNC controllers streamline the automation process, making it easier for operators to conduct complex tasks with less manual intervention. This not only speeds up production but also minimizes the risk of human error, ensuring a consistent quality output. For automotive manufacturers, where margins for error are minimal, this is a critical advantage.

Different materials present unique challenges in machining. Flat CNC lathes are versatile; they can handle a wide variety of materials, including metals, plastics, and composites. This adaptability means that manufacturers can easily switch materials based on project requirements without needing to invest in different machines.
Time is a critical factor in automotive manufacturing. Flat CNC lathes not only speed up the machining process but also decrease the number of processes required. For instance, components that once needed multiple setups can often be produced in a single operation with a flat CNC lathe, significantly shortening production timelines.
With the integrated technology of CNC controllers, manufacturers can implement rigorous quality control measures throughout the production process. Real-time data monitoring and adaptability allow for immediate adjustments, ensuring that each part meets the required specifications and standards.
